As it turns out, Trump's decree regarding the creation of a cryptocurrency reserve does not provide for the purchase of cryptocurrency - only the transfer of digital money that is already in the government's possession into the reserve.
This refers to bitcoins that have been confiscated from criminals. Their total is estimated at 200,000 (which is approximately 17 billion dollars at the current exchange rate), but a detailed audit has never been conducted. The bitcoins added to the reserve are not subject to sale - they will be held as a means of savings.
